#210bf4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#210bf4 is composed of 12.9% red, 4.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.5%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 50%. #210bf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4216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#210bf4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#210bf4 has RGB values of R:33, G:11,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2165748.

Shades and Tints of #210bf4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030113 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#210bf4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797788 is the less saturated color, while #1901fe is the most saturated one.
